This is a good overview of the Aztec empire from Nigel Davies, a British expat gentleman scholar who enjoyed ancient Meso-american cultures apparently. I may have better books on the empire, but it does have some images I've never seen, and actually a fairly detailed history of Nezahualcoyotl which is sort of an interesting character, in that he is sort of made out to be a poet-king, etc.
